Overall Meaning

In "A Father's Love," Delilah sings about the special bond between a father and his child. The song starts with the image of a young child asking endless questions to his father, who doesn't always have the answers. Despite this, the child looks up to his father and sees him as the smartest man alive. The father reassures his child that he will always be there for him, reminding him that his father's love is a promise from heaven above.


The chorus emphasizes the power and strength of a father's love. It is something that can be depended on, especially during difficult times when the child is feeling lonely or lost. The second verse speaks directly to the child, reassuring him that even after the father has passed away, his love will continue to live on in the child. The father wonders if he was there enough for his child, if he hugged and cared enough. Nonetheless, he trusts that his child will always feel the power of his father's love.


Overall, "A Father's Love" is a poignant tribute to the special relationship between a father and his child. It highlights the importance of a father's influence and the unconditional love that he can offer.
